halbă is a 1651 by Unknown, a Baroque work, depicting Flower, held at Ethnographical Museum of Transylvania.
This is a tall, blue ceramic jug with a wooden lid and handle. The body is decorated with white flowers, yellow leaves, and a gold band near the bottom. The jug has a sturdy base and a spout for pouring. The design looks like it’s from a time when people loved detailed, colorful patterns.
